I've had a Comfortz inner topper for years now, and it's been great. However, the plasticard thingy's which hold up the liner are all now falling out of the gaps in the roof lining - through age - and the topper is sagging all of the way round, which is not so good.

I thought that the easiest way to solve this is to attach stick-on velcro at intervals to the pop top canvas inner, and then simply affix the inner to them. Just wondering whether sticking velcro to the canvas is likely to invite leaks in the rain - you know like touching the canvas when it rains. Any views gratefully received? Thanks.
 
I have used Velcro to re-attach parts of my sagging Brandrup pop-top several times and on each occasion it fell off again after a day or two. No idea whether it affects the waterproof-ness as it doesn’t stick on successfully.
 
If the plastic are bits are falling out, stick some Velcro on them use the hooked pieces rather than the loop side, it makes the plastic thicker and the Velcro grips the headlining.
